Xen up to 4.10.x Hypervisor PV Guest out-of-bounds write

Detailsinfo

A vulnerability, which was classified as problematic, was found in Xen up to 4.10.x (Virtualization Software). Affected is an unknown functionality of the component Hypervisor. The manipulation as part of a PV Guest leads to a out-of-bounds write vulnerability. CWE is classifying the issue as CWE-787. The product writes data past the end, or before the beginning, of the intended buffer. This is going to have an impact on availability. CVE summarizes:

An issue was discovered in Xen through 4.10.x allowing x86 PV guest OS users to cause a denial of service (out-of-bounds zero write and hypervisor crash) via unexpected INT 80 processing, because of an incorrect fix for CVE-2017-5754.

The bug was discovered 04/25/2018. The weakness was shared 04/27/2018 by Andrew Cooper with Citrix as XSA-259 as confirmed security advisory (Website). The advisory is available at xenbits.xen.org. This vulnerability is traded as CVE-2018-10471 since 04/27/2018. The exploitability is told to be easy. Local access is required to approach this attack. The exploitation doesn't require any form of authentication. The technical details are unknown and an exploit is not available.

The vulnerability was handled as a non-public zero-day exploit for at least 2 days. During that time the estimated underground price was around $0-$5k. The vulnerability scanner Nessus provides a plugin with the ID 109677 (SUSE SLED12 / SLES12 Security Update : xen (SUSE-SU-2018:1184-1) (Meltdown)), which helps to determine the existence of the flaw in a target environment. It is assigned to the family SuSE Local Security Checks and running in the context l. The commercial vulnerability scanner Qualys is able to test this issue with plugin 176380 (Debian Security Update for xen (DSA 4201-1)).

Applying a patch is able to eliminate this problem. A possible mitigation has been published immediately after the disclosure of the vulnerability.
